Flight Attendant Tries to Bring Loaded Gun Through Airport Security
Basically, a flight attendant somehow forgot she was carrying in her purse, and she was taken to security. While there, the police officer fired the s&w air weight while trying to unload it.
Now I'm not one of those guys who says that ALL AD's are due to incompetence (or that it could NEVER happen to me), but how can you be a police officer in an airport and not know how to unload a revolver. Also, this was not a matter of carelessly pulling the trigger while going thru hundreds of rounds at the range. This was a high security situation where there should have been no lack of focus or concentration.
On a separate note, she was only charged with disorderly conduct. I wonder what would have happened if you or I got into the same scenario.
